Ostwald Ripening is a paradigm for statistical selfsimilarity in coarsening systems. Thie means that after a transient stage the particle number density evolves in a unique selfsimilar fashion, which is independent of the details of the initial data. Ostwald Ripening Ostwald Ripening

Ostwald Ripening

Ostwald ripening or coarsening is a process where the total energy of a twophase system is decreased with an increase in the size scale (Voorhees, 1985 ). In case of nanocrystals, there is a range of particle size distribution, and thus there are particles of different sizes. With time or in solution, there is diffusion of smaller particles ...
